Best toy storage advice someone gave me was buy TONS of clear bins to store toys in then buy a bunch of cute baskets that you like to look at…throw the toys they currently play with in the baskets (this makes it so easy to pick up because you literally just throw everything in it..plus kids find it awesome to slam dunk toys in to baskets!) then when they want different toys put the basket stuff back in clear bins to store for later! It keeps my house looking so clean and people always comment how they don’t understand how i keep a tidy house with kids!! Target and Land of Nod are the best places for cute baskets!

Just adding my $0.02 on toy shelves. Don’t get something where you are tied into using specifically sized baskets. Just get a set of open shelves. As you children age they will want different kinds toys and you will be able to use the space differently. Most importantly if this is where the toys live don’t allow them to overflow the space. If you have more toys than can fit it’s time for something to go!

Toy storage: ditto on open shelves. I have bookcases and put bins on the bottom shelves for toys, another shelf for puzzles/games and another shelf for books. You could even put some art supplies there eventually (maybe not yet). We have a small house so one shelf right now has sidewalk chalk and bubbles, which will hopefully get moved once it gets cold…but honestly, maybe not! Oh, and my bookcases have adjustable shelf height so we can adapt. The game shelf is ridic right now!
